Tax Deductibility - Overseas Aid Gift Deduction Scheme
The Overseas Aid Gift Deduction Scheme (OAGDS) enables donations collected by organisations for their overseas aid activities to be tax deductible. That is, it allows donors to claim their contributions to the organisation as a tax deduction. There is a two-step process to achieve tax deductibility under the OAGDS. The first step is administered by AusAID and the second step is administered by the Australian Taxation Office and Department of Treasury.
